Transaction 2bf140ea4e7e6ea75290214b63f2b82cff138eb2b0f2cc00469131c245971489

1 Input
2 Outputs
  • 2bf140ea4e7e6ea75290214b63f2b82cff138eb2b0f2cc00469131c245971489:0
  • value  9058217781
    address  38vqgxyzWCGyXRPPUwjT9UY6A7XLC59uq9
  • 2bf140ea4e7e6ea75290214b63f2b82cff138eb2b0f2cc00469131c245971489:1
  • value  2302462
    address  14PTKNcGSH3T774HxawYgbcU1rhtgJ2uKC